    Directions:

    1. 1
      Combine dry ingredients. Add wet ingredients and stif until just combined.
    2. 2
      Pour into a greased 8 x 8 inch pan. Bake at 350 for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
    3. 3
      Allow to cool slightly before cutting.

      This one caught my eye because of the use of whole wheat flour instead of white (I'm always looking to make some of my favorite sides healthier!) The honey adds a nice sweetness, but I think it still needs a little something to soften the overall texture, since whole wheat flour creates a coarser texture than white flour. Next time, I would add an 8 oz can of corn to it. Thanks for sharing! Made for PAC Spring 2011.
